Waterproof and Breathable Clothing

Wearing clothes that is waterproof and breathable will give you the courage to face the weather. To keep the rain off while allowing your body breathe, look for coats and trousers made of fabrics like Gore-Tex or nylon.

The Perfect Footwear

The appropriate footwear will keep your feet warm and secure. To navigate slick conditions and shield your feet from the rain, choose waterproof shoes with superior grip.

Give It a Thorough Clean

The first step in post-ride maintenance is to give your e-bike a thorough clean. For the washing of the frame, wheels, and components, employ a moistened fabric along with a gentle soap mixture. Pay extra attention to areas where dirt, mud, or debris may have accumulated during your ride. Not only does a clean electric bicycle look fantastic, but it also operates more effectively.

Dry It Off

After cleaning, towel-dry your Maxfoot E-Bike to prevent rust and corrosion. Make sure to dry off all the nooks and crannies, including the chain, drivetrain, and brake calipers. If you were stuck in the mud or rain during your ride, you might use compressed air to release the water.

Lubricate the Chain

For a performance that is both smooth and effective, it is essential to have a chain that has been well oiled. After drying off the chain, apply a quality chain lubricant to ensure it remains well-conditioned and free from rust. To avoid the accumulation of dirt, remember to remove any excess lubrication before wiping it off.
